Kiera is responsible for leading and advancing Target’s enterprise-wide DE&I strategy as well as leading our talent and change team and strategy. Kiera Fernandez serves as the senior vice president, talent and change, and chief diversity & inclusion officer. Meet our Chief Diversity and Inclusion Officer Kiera Fernandez Our DE&I strategy focuses on four areas: creating an inclusive guest experience, having an inclusive work environment, ensuring we have a diverse workforce and leveraging our influence to drive positive impact on society.
